As a Content Creator, you will be responsible to create high-quality video and visual content that supports STM Lottery's corporate communications, brand positioning, community engagement and digital communications initiatives. This role offers the opportunity to bring your creativity to the forefront, crafting content that drives our brand awareness and engagement to new heights.
What You'll Be Doing
- Video Production
- Conceptualise, script, storyboard, shoot and edit video content for corporate communications and digital platforms.
- Produce short-form videos, reels, interviews, event coverage, corporate videos and other visual storytelling content.
- Handle camera operation, lighting, sound recording and basic production setup.
- Edit footage, perform basic colour correction, audio enhancement, motion graphics and subtitling.
- Adapt content into different formats for Instagram, Facebook, TikTok, YouTube, LinkedIn and other relevant platforms.
- Photography & Visual Content
- Capture photographs for corporate events, CSR programmes, internal communications and digital platforms.
- Produce supporting graphics, thumbnails, infographics and other visual assets where required.
- Content Development
- Work with the Communications team to develop creative concepts aligned with corporate campaigns and communication objectives.
- Translate corporate initiatives, community programmes and organisational activities into engaging visual stories.
- Maintain a content calendar and support the execution of digital campaigns.
- Monitor social media trends, formats and audience behaviour.
- Identify opportunities to improve the reach and engagement of STM Lottery's visual content.
- Monitor content performance and provide insights to improve future video and visual content.
What We're Looking For
- Diploma/Degree in Multimedia, Film, Mass Communications, Graphic Design, Animation, Digital Media or a related discipline.
- Minimum 1 to 3 years of practical experience in videography, video production, content creation or a related field.
- Strong proficiency in Adobe Premiere Pro and After Effects or equivalent professional video-editing software.
- Working knowledge of Photoshop and Illustrator is an advantage.
- Good understanding of video composition, lighting, audio recording and visual storytelling.
- Experience producing short-form content for social media platforms.
- Drone videography and photography skills are an advantage.
- Strong creative and conceptual thinking with the ability to turn ideas into engaging visual content.
- Good communication and interpersonal skills.
- Able to work independently as well as collaboratively with the team.
- Willingness to travel for events, corporate activities and content production when required.
